A pyramid has a square base with sides 100 feet long. The original height was 75 feet.

Answer:

99.2%

Step-by-step explanation:

Ratio of volumes = (Ratio of sides)³

Ratio of volumes = (15/75)³

Ratio of volumes = 1/125

1/125 × 100 = 0.8% was cut off

100 - 0.8 = 99.2% remains

Answer:

The mean of the sampling distribution of the proportion of downloaded books is 0.03 and the standard deviation is 0.0197.

Step-by-step explanation:

Central Limit Theorem

For a proportion p in a sample of size n, the sampling distribution of the sample proportion will be approximately normal with mean \mu = p and standard deviation s = \sqrt{\frac{p(1-p)}{n}}

3% of books borrowed from a library in a year are downloaded.

This means that p = 0.03

SRS of 75 books.

This means that n = 75

What are the mean and standard deviation of the sampling distribution of the proportion of downloaded books

By the Central Limit Theorem

Mean: \mu = p = 0.03

Standard deviation: s = \sqrt{\frac{p(1-p)}{n}} = \sqrt{\frac{0.03*0.97}{75}} = 0.0197

The mean of the sampling distribution of the proportion of downloaded books is 0.03 and the standard deviation is 0.0197.
